I've been using the LED minimag mainly and I have one other LED light but can't think of the name (uses 3 AAA), but I need something to fit my current situation.

I need a light with the tactical pressure switch option and the RED lense cover. Needs to have at least 3 modes: a really low, a mid, and a really high. Want something around or over 200 Lumens (filter may cut light output), but need to be able to be on for awhile without overheating.
Strobe is not needed but I wouldn't mind having it.
Needs to be very well built, and water proof in case its dropped in a puddle.

Purpose:
I want a light small enough to mount on my bow stabilizer (< 8 inches) for hog hunting and I want the adjustable brightness so I can conserve the batteries when walking to and from stand.

Needs to shine a tight beam (with the red filter ON) 20-30 yards with lots of spill to see other hogs nearby so I'm not caught by suprise by their presence.

I had considered the Fenix P3D Premium Q5 with Cree 7090 XR-E using 2xcr123 cells at 215 Lumens but someone on youtube said the red filter lense is a loose fit ( don't want to have to rig something to fit like a glove).

I also saw their is a PD30 (R4) 265 Lumens (on Fenix's website). Have not seen any youtube videos to demonstrate the beam on this light. Is the spill similar to the P3D (Q5)?

Also considered the TK12 (R2), (listed on ebay and Maxpedition). Is this light "real" since the fenixlight.com does not list an R2 on the TK12?

I am also trying to find a reputable dealer/supplier that has the real deal and not knock-offs but without the crazy markups or outrageous shipping (ie $22 <- from Canada).

Cost for the light without the filter and pressure switch needs to be less than $100.
